Green Card
The Green Card, officially the Permanent Resident Card (Form I-551), grants eligible foreign nationals lawful permanent resident status in the United States, allowing them to live and work indefinitely while enjoying many rights akin to citizens, such as owning property and accessing public benefits. Holders must renew it every 10 years, maintain continuous residence to avoid abandonment, and can apply for citizenship after typically five years, but it does not permit voting or holding certain public offices.

Citizenship
U.S. citizenship confers full legal membership in the nation, granting rights like voting in federal elections, running for office, obtaining a U.S. passport, and sponsoring unlimited family members for immigration. It can be acquired by birth in the U.S., through citizen parents abroad, or via naturalization for eligible permanent residents who meet residency requirements, pass English/civics tests, and swear an Oath of Allegiance.

Passport
A U.S. passport is an internationally recognized travel document issued exclusively to citizens, verifying identity and nationality for foreign entry, visa applications, and global mobility, often providing visa-free access to over 180 countries. It serves as undeniable proof of citizenship, is valid for 10 years for adults (5 for minors), and requires renewal before expiration to avoid travel disruptions.

Employment Card
The Employment Authorization Document (EAD), commonly called a work permit or Employment Card (Form I-766), allows certain non-citizens—such as asylum seekers, DACA recipients, or visa holders—to legally work in the U.S. for any employer. Issued for one to two years and renewable, it requires proof of eligibility and is essential for employment verification via E-Verify, though it does not confer permanent status.

Travel Documents
A U.S. travel document, such as the Refugee Travel Document (Form I-571) or Re-entry Permit (Form I-327), is issued to lawful permanent residents, refugees, or asylees who lack a valid passport from their home country, enabling safe international travel without jeopardizing their U.S. immigration status. These documents are crucial for extended trips abroad, as absence without one can lead to loss of residency; they are valid for up to two years and must be obtained before leaving the U.S.

Driver License
A U.S. driver's license is a state-issued identification and authorization to operate a motor vehicle, required for legal driving and often serving as primary ID for banking, employment, and other services. For immigrants, eligibility varies by state but generally requires proof of legal status (like a Green Card or visa), residency, and passing written/vision/road tests; REAL ID-compliant versions, enhanced for federal purposes like boarding flights, became mandatory in many states by 2025.
